Lenin Rediscovered: 'What is to be Done?' in Context
by Lars T. Lih
ISBN 13: 9781931859585
Format: Paperback (880 pages) Publisher: HAYMARKET BOOKS Published: 02 Jul 2008
Save for later
Lenin (Critical Lives)
ISBN 13: 9781861897930
Format: Paperback (235 pages) Publisher: Reaktion Books Published: 09 Mar 2011